Registered Nursing at Yavapai College

What traits are you looking for in a school for Registered Nursing, take a look at what Yavapai College. We’ve gathered the following information to help you decide.

Yavapai College is in Prescott, AZ.

During the most recent reporting year, 92 registered nursing graduations were recorded at Yavapai College.

Online & Distance Learning at Yavapai College

Distance learning is available at Yavapai College. Of 7,428 students, 2,229 (30%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 1,377 (19%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

Below you’ll find the diversity of Registered Nursing graduates at Yavapai College, broken down by degree level.

Program-wide, Registered Nursing graduates at Yavapai College are 83% women (76) and 17% men (16).

Registered Nursing Associate’s Program at Yavapai College

Of the 92 associate’s registered nursing degrees awarded at Yavapai College, 83% were women (76) and 17% were men (16).

Yavapai College gender breakdown of Registered Nursing Associate's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Registered Nursing associate’s degree recipients at Yavapai College.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 58
Hispanic / Latino 19
Black / African American 1
Asian 3
American Indian / Alaska Native 1
Native Hawaiian / Pacific Islander 2
Two or More Races 2
Unknown 6
Racial-ethnic diversity of Registered Nursing majors at Yavapai College

Minority students account for 30% of Registered Nursing associate’s degree recipients at Yavapai College, lower than the national average of 43%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
